Nuggets upend Pacers 113-109

INDIANAPOLIS (AP) -- Ty Lawson scored 27 points to lead the Denver Nuggets to a 113-109 win over the Indiana Pacers on Saturday night.

The Nuggets snapped their five-game losing streak with the win.

Danny Granger scored 26 points for the Pacers, who have lost four of five.

Arron Afflalo had 23 points and five rebounds and Corey Brewer had 19 points and five rebounds in his first game back after missing three straight because of the death of his father.

The Nuggets, who jumped to a 10-point lead in the fourth quarter after never taking more than a six-point lead in the first three quarters, survived a late run by the Pacers.

Indiana got back within a point late in the game and the Nuggets pulled away from the free throw line.
